Thea Hamre, a graduate of Eden Prairie High School in Eden Prairie, Minnesota has been named to the dean’s list for the fall 2020 semester at St. Catherine University in St. Paul, MN. The undergraduate student is a junior at St. Kate’s majoring in social work and is the child of Cynthia and Jack Hamre of Eden Prairie, MN.
The St. Catherine University dean’s list recognizes students who achieve a semester grade point average of 3.667 or higher.
About St. Catherine University
A dynamic university located in St. Paul, Minnesota, St. Catherine University prepares students to make a difference in their profession, their communities, and the world. The University is home to nearly 5,000 students in associate, bachelor’s, master’s, doctorate, and certificate programs. Granting bachelor’s degrees in more than 60 majors, St. Kate’s College for Women is the largest private women’s college in the nation.
